Investors Tyler Saldutti and Neil Hemenway bought Murray Hill Plaza at 1064-1080 Edgewood Ave. S. for $1.2 million.

Saldutti, who is CEO of Prime Realty LLC, said the 13,800-square-foot property on about 0.87 acres is fully occupied.

Saldutti said the investors bought the property through Murray Hill Plaza LLC from Tallahassee firm Omnimax Inc.

He said the property was built in 1951 and renovated in 2013. Tenants include Tobacco Galore, Grater Good Cheese Shop, Bernie's Wine Shop and Avondale Dance Studio.

Eric Yi and Austin Kay with Prime Realty represented the buyer and the seller in the off-market transaction.

“It's just a bet that good things will happen in Murray Hill,” Saldutti said of the neighborhood near Riverside and Avondale.
